Output 716c28d423858fb8d14de76a6540285d8b8a9346072923a3c2611aeb680351af:17

value
166654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c8fdf217e452b45340d4c9b6cba468eaf8d77a9 OP_EQUAL
address
3Jt3JyvTG1hLUMJyGNpfkdjYuKAntbBKjZ
transaction
716c28d423858fb8d14de76a6540285d8b8a9346072923a3c2611aeb680351af
spent
true